What Features Should You Look For in the Best Scrubbers for Glasstop Stoves?
When searching for the best scrubbers for glasstop stoves, consider the following features:
- Non-abrasive Materials: Look for scrubbers made from non-abrasive materials to prevent scratching the glass surface. Abrasive materials can cause irreversible damage, leading to costly repairs or replacements.
- Heat Resistance: The scrubber should be heat resistant to withstand the high temperatures that can occur during cooking. This feature ensures that the scrubber will not melt or deform when used on a hot stovetop.
- Effective Cleaning Ability: Choose scrubbers that are designed specifically for tough stains and burnt-on food. Effective cleaning ability is essential for maintaining the appearance and hygiene of your glasstop stove.
- Ergonomic Design: A scrubber with an ergonomic design allows for a comfortable grip, making it easier to clean without straining your hands or wrists. This feature is particularly important for prolonged cleaning sessions.
- Durability: Opt for scrubbers that are durable and long-lasting, able to withstand regular use without falling apart. A durable scrubber will save you money in the long run by reducing the need for frequent replacements.
- Easy to Clean: Select scrubbers that are easy to rinse and dry after use. This feature helps maintain hygiene and ensures that the scrubber remains effective over time.
- Size and Shape: Look for scrubbers that come in various sizes and shapes to reach all areas of your glasstop stove, including corners and tight spaces. The right size and shape will enhance your cleaning efficiency.

What Common Mistakes Should You Avoid When Using Scrubbers on Glasstop Stoves?
When using scrubbers on glasstop stoves, it’s essential to avoid several common mistakes to maintain the surface’s integrity.
- Using Abrasive Materials: Many scrubbers are made from harsh materials that can scratch and damage the smooth surface of a glasstop stove. It’s important to choose scrubbers that are specifically designed for glass or ceramic surfaces to prevent long-term damage.
- Applying Excessive Pressure: Scrubbing too hard can lead to scratches or even cracks in the glasstop. A gentle touch is usually sufficient, and using a circular motion can help lift stubborn residues without harming the surface.
- Ignoring Manufacturer Recommendations: Each glasstop stove comes with manufacturer care instructions, which may specify what types of scrubbers and cleaners are safe to use. Ignoring these guidelines can void warranties and result in damage.
- Using Stiff-bristled Brushes: Stiff brushes can be too aggressive for glasstop surfaces, leading to scratches. Instead, opt for soft-bristled brushes or non-abrasive pads that can clean effectively without causing harm.
- Cleaning While Hot: Attempting to clean a glasstop stove while it is still hot can not only be dangerous but can also cause the scrubber to warp or degrade. Always wait for the stove to cool down before cleaning to ensure safety and efficacy.
- Neglecting Regular Maintenance: Allowing spills and stains to sit for too long can make them more difficult to clean and may necessitate harsher scrubbing methods. Regular maintenance and cleaning after each use can help prevent buildup and reduce the need for aggressive scrubbing.

What Damage Can Incorrect Scrubbing Cause to Your Stove?
Using incorrect scrubbing techniques or tools can lead to various types of damage to your glasstop stove.
- Scratches: Using abrasive scrubbers can create fine scratches on the surface of a glasstop stove, which not only affects its appearance but can also make it more difficult to clean in the future.
- Discoloration: Harsh cleaners or scrubbing pads can lead to discoloration of the glass, resulting in a dull or stained surface that detracts from the stove’s overall aesthetic.
- Cracks: Excessive force or the use of sharp objects can cause cracks in the glasstop, which may compromise the stove’s functionality and safety, leading to costly repairs or replacements.
